Beaches Branch library to temporarily close for HVAC replacement

The Beaches Branch Library is preparing for a temporary shutdown lasting about two weeks to facilitate the installation of a new HVAC system. Here’s what you need to know about the closure.

NEPTUNE BEACH, Fla. — The Jacksonville Public Library’s sole outpost near the beach will temporarily shutter its doors starting Monday, October 27, for essential HVAC upgrades. Officials anticipate welcoming patrons back in mid-November.

During this period, the library’s book drop will be unavailable. Any books on hold or requested for pickup will be redirected to the Pablo Creek Regional Library located on Beach Boulevard, the nearest alternative branch.

Library users wishing to transfer their holds to a different Jacksonville Public Library branch can do so easily through the library’s website, mobile app, or by contacting the library at 904-255-2665.

For information on all 20 other library branches and their operating hours, please visit the Jacksonville Public Library’s website.

E-books, audiobooks, movies and other content can still be accessed online through the Digital Library service.
